Figure 13.16 Staircase lighting circuit
Two two-way switches have been used to control the lamp L. Fig. 13.16 (a)
shows the schematic diagram whereas Fig. 13.16 (b) shows the actual wiring
diagram. Switch S is fixed on the ground floor near the staircase while
1
switch S is fixed on the first floor. While going up S is operated to switch
2
1
on the light L as shown. After reaching the first floor, switch S is operated.
2
The switch contact moves to position shown by the dotted line. The lamp gits
switched off as power supply to the lamp is now cut off.
